On This Day in 2023, Australia completed one of the most commanding performances in a major ICC final when they defeated India by 209 runs to win the World Test Championship at The Oval. The victory on June 11, 2023, secured Australia’s first World Test Championship title and added another major global crown to a cricketing resume that already included success in the ODI and T20 World Cups.
The final was effectively shaped on the opening two days of the match. After being asked to bat first, Australia recovered from an uncertain start through a match-defining partnership between Travis Head and Steve Smith. Head played with his trademark aggression and fluency, scoring 163 from 174 deliveries, while Smith produced a measured 121 from 268 balls. Their stand of 285 transformed the contest and carried Australia to a formidable first-innings total of 469. At a venue where scoreboard pressure often dictates the direction of a Test match, Australia had established complete control.
India’s reply never quite reached the same level of authority. Ajinkya Rahane, playing his first Test after a lengthy absence from the side, produced a fighting 89, while Shardul Thakur added a valuable half-century. Ravindra Jadeja also contributed useful runs, but Australia consistently found breakthroughs at crucial moments. India were eventually dismissed for 296, conceding a first-innings deficit of 173 runs. The gap was significant not only numerically but also in terms of momentum, with Australia maintaining a clear advantage throughout the contest.
Australia’s second innings was built on pragmatism rather than urgency. Contributions from Marnus Labuschagne and Alex Carey helped extend the lead before captain Pat Cummins declared at 270 for 8. The declaration set India a target of 444, a chase that would have required one of the greatest fourth-innings efforts in Test history. Instead, Australia steadily tightened their grip on the match. Their bowlers operated with discipline, extracting enough assistance from the surface while maintaining relentless accuracy.
India began the final day needing a remarkable effort, but wickets fell at regular intervals. Rohit Sharma made 43 and Virat Kohli briefly offered resistance, yet Australia never allowed a sustained partnership to develop. The dismissal of Kohli early on the fifth morning proved especially important, and from there the chase gradually unravelled. Nathan Lyon’s off-spin and the seamers’ persistence ensured India were bowled out for 234, sealing a comprehensive Australian victory.
The result reflected Australia’s superiority across every major phase of the match. They produced the two highest individual scores of the game, built the most significant partnership, held their catches under pressure and executed their bowling plans with consistency. Head was deservedly named Player of the Match for an innings that changed the course of the final and remains one of the defining knocks in modern Australian Test cricket.
For Australia, the triumph completed a long pursuit of the Test mace and confirmed their status as the inaugural champions from the 2021-23 World Test Championship cycle. Three years later, the performance at The Oval remains a benchmark for how to win a Test final: seize the key moments, build scoreboard pressure and maintain control from start to finish.
